Key Concepts and Overview

Sports betting bonuses and promotions are incentives offered by bookmakers to encourage betting activity. They come in various forms, each designed to appeal to different types of bettors. The most common types include:

  • Welcome Bonuses: These are offered to new customers as a way to entice them to sign up and start betting.
  • Free Bets: This type of promotion allows bettors to place a wager without risking their own money.
  • Deposit Bonuses: These bonuses match a percentage of the amount a bettor deposits into their account.
  • Loyalty Programs: Designed to reward regular customers with points or bonuses for their continued patronage.

Main Features and Details

Each type of bonus has specific features and conditions that bettors must be aware of. Here’s a breakdown of the important components:

  • Wagering Requirements: Most bonuses come with wagering requirements, which dictate how many times a bettor must wager the bonus amount before they can withdraw any winnings.
  • Minimum Odds: Some promotions require bets to be placed at minimum odds to qualify for the bonus.
  • Expiration Dates: Bonuses often have a limited time frame within which they must be used, adding urgency to the betting process.
  • Eligible Markets: Certain bonuses may only apply to specific sports or events, so it’s crucial to check the terms and conditions.

Practical Examples and Use Cases

To illustrate how sports betting bonuses work in practice, consider the following scenarios:

  • Welcome Bonus Example: A new bettor signs up with a sportsbook offering a 100% welcome bonus up to $200. They deposit $200 and receive an additional $200 in bonus funds, giving them a total of $400 to bet with.
  • Free Bet Scenario: A bettor receives a $50 free bet after placing their first wager. They can use this free bet on any event, allowing them to explore different betting options without financial risk.
  • Loyalty Program Use: An experienced gambler regularly bets on their favorite sports and accumulates points through a loyalty program. These points can be redeemed for free bets or other rewards, enhancing their overall betting experience.

Advantages and Disadvantages

While sports betting bonuses offer numerous benefits, they also come with potential downsides. Here’s a balanced analysis:

  • Advantages:
    • Increased betting capital through bonuses allows for more extensive wagering.
    • Free bets provide a risk-free opportunity to explore new betting markets.
    • Loyalty programs reward consistent betting behavior, enhancing customer satisfaction.
  • Disadvantages:
    • Wagering requirements can make it challenging to withdraw winnings.
    • Complex terms and conditions may lead to confusion and missed opportunities.
    • Some promotions may encourage reckless betting behavior in pursuit of bonuses.
